Multi-objective Design of Process Parameter Based On Game Theory

摘要

Taking the processing time,the processing cost per workpiece as objective funtion,two optimization model is established.Multi-objective solving method based on nash equilibrium game model is put forward.Taking the sub-objective function of multi-objective optimization model as game party,all design variable as strategy set,calculation steps of process parameter multi-objective optimization based on game analysis are founded.As turing technology an example,the result of analysis show multi-objective game design method is effective and feasible.
机译:以加工时间,单位工件加工成本为目标函数,建立两个优化模型。提出了基于纳什均衡博弈模型的多目标求解方法。以多目标优化模型的子目标函数为博弈方。建立了所有设计变量作为策略集,建立了基于博弈分析的过程参数多目标优化计算步骤。以图尔技术为例,分析结果表明多目标博弈设计方法是有效可行的。
